要提高 CentOS 系统中 swapper(交换分区)的读写速度,可以尝试以下方法:
增加交换分区大小:
使用 SSD:
调整 swappiness 参数:
swappiness 是一个内核参数,它决定了操作系统在使用交换空间之前会尝试释放多少内存。默认值通常是 30,但你可以根据需要调整它。swappiness 值,可以使用以下命令:sysctl vm.swappiness
swappiness 值,可以使用以下命令(将值设置为 10):sudo sysctl vm.swappiness=10
swappiness 值,请编辑 /etc/sysctl.conf 文件,并添加或修改以下行:vm.swappiness=10
sudo sysctl -p 使更改生效。优化文件系统:
监控交换分区使用情况:
free 或 top 命令来查看内存和交换分区的使用情况。考虑使用 ZRAM:
升级硬件:
请注意,在进行任何更改之前,建议备份重要数据,并确保你了解每个更改的影响。如果你不确定如何进行操作,建议咨询专业人士的意见。